MC74HCT08ADTR2G Features

  • Logic Type: AND Gate
  • Max Propagation Delay: 17ns @ 5V, 50pF
  • Voltage - Supply: 2V ~ 6V
  • Input Logic Level - High: 2V
  • Input Logic Level - Low: 0.8V
  • Current - Quiescent (Max): 1 µA
  • Current - Output High, Low: 4mA, 4mA
  • Number of Inputs: 2
  • Number of Circuits: 4
  • Mounting Type: Surface Mount
  • Package: Tape & Reel (TR)
  • RoHS Status: ROHS3 Compliant
  • REACH Status: REACH Unaffected
  • Moisture Sensitivity Level (MSL): 1 (Unlimited)
